Why Stabilizers Matter

Stabilizers are the behind-the-scenes heroes of skincare, ensuring products remain **effective, safe, and long-lasting**. This category includes antioxidants, pH stabilizers, and preservatives, each serving a unique role in maintaining the integrity of formulations.

Key Stabilizers and Their Roles

Category Example Function Why It’s Important
Antioxidants Vitamin E, Green Tea Extract Prevents oxidation, extends product shelf life Protects active ingredients from degrading and supports skin health
pH Stabilizers Citric Acid, Lactic Acid Balances pH levels in formulations Ensures the product remains skin-friendly and effective
Preservatives Optiphen Plus, Leucidal Liquid Prevents microbial growth Keeps products safe and free from harmful bacteria and mold

How pH Impacts Skincare

Maintaining the right pH balance is **crucial for skin health**. The skin’s natural barrier, also known as the **acid mantle**, thrives at a pH of around 4.5 to 5.5. Skincare products that are too alkaline or too acidic can **disrupt this balance**, leading to irritation, dryness, or breakouts.

Did You Know?

Vitamin E is not just a powerful antioxidant for the skin—it also helps **stabilize oils in formulations**, preventing them from going rancid and extending their usability!
